Political courage can be a rare commodity in today's world, where politicians often prioritize their own careers and interests over those of their constituents. However, there have been a number of politicians throughout history who have displayed tremendous bravery and integrity in the face of immense pressure and opposition.

One example of political courage is Mahatma Gandhi's nonviolent resistance movement in India. Gandhi was a vocal critic of British colonial rule and worked tirelessly to peacefully advocate for India's independence. Despite facing arrest and persecution, Gandhi remained committed to his beliefs and inspired millions of people to join him in his campaign for justice.

Another example of political courage is Nelson Mandela, who fought against the oppressive apartheid regime in South Africa. Mandela spent 27 years in prison for his activism, but he never wavered in his commitment to justice and equality. Upon his release, he became the country's first black president and worked to heal the wounds of a divided nation.

In more recent times, we have seen examples of political courage from politicians like John McCain and Elizabeth Warren. McCain, a senator from Arizona, was known for his independence and willingness to buck his own party when he felt it was the right thing to do. He was a strong advocate for campaign finance reform and stood up to President George W. Bush on issues like torture and the Iraq War. Warren, a senator from Massachusetts, has also shown political courage by standing up to powerful interests and advocating for policies that benefit the middle class.

Political courage is not easy to come by, but it is essential for a healthy democracy. These examples serve as a reminder that, even in the face of great adversity, it is possible for politicians to put their principles above their own self-interest and make a positive difference in the world.
